    Laughlin used to be extremely busy with lots of snowbirds...

    Laughlin used to be extremely busy with lots of snowbirds and people, however Laughlin must be changing or those of us old folks are staying home. The Tropicana was virtually dead! Hardly any people there. We did wonder on down to the Aquarius and the Golden Nugget and those casinos seemed to be much busier. I know that Tropicana is not on the river and perhaps that is the draw but even then, it did not account for the lack of people. The shopping mall is also a ghost town. There was once a huge crowd shopping for the holidays but now there is about one-third of the stores open and if there were 50 people in total shopping, that is stretching it.

    Laughlin is a great place to stay whilst you explore that...

    Laughlin is a great place to stay whilst you explore that greater area. Close to Route 66. RIGHT on the Colorado River, some rooms with river view. You could stay four nights and go on a day trip in three different directions to explore and enjoy the area. Or rent a Jet Ski or go on a boat trip. Also plenty of bars and restaurants in the Casino’s. It’s more than Casino though, much more. Sometimes we never even set foot in the casino except to check in.
